The Internet PortalThe Internet (or internet) is the global system of interconnected computer networks that uses the Internet protocol suite (TCP/IP) to communicate between networks and devices. It is a network of networks that consists of private, public, academic, business, and government networks of local to global scope, linked by a broad array of electronic, wireless, and optical networking technologies. The Internet carries a vast range of information resources and services, such as the interlinked hypertext documents and applications of the World Wide Web (WWW), electronic mail, internet telephony, streaming media and file sharing. The origins of the Internet date back to research that enabled the time-sharing of computer resources, the development of packet switching in the 1960s and the design of computer networks for data communication. The set of rules (communication protocols) to enable internetworking on the Internet arose from research and development commissioned in the 1970s by the Defense Advanced Research Projects Agency (DARPA) of the United States Department of Defense in collaboration with universities and researchers across the United States and in the United Kingdom and France. The ARPANET initially served as a backbone for the interconnection of regional academic and military networks in the United States to enable resource sharing. The funding of the National Science Foundation Network as a new backbone in the 1980s, as well as private funding for other commercial extensions, encouraged worldwide participation in the development of new networking technologies and the merger of many networks using DARPA's Internet protocol suite. The linking of commercial networks and enterprises by the early 1990s, as well as the advent of the World Wide Web, marked the beginning of the transition to the modern Internet, and generated sustained exponential growth as generations of institutional, personal, and mobile computers were connected to the internetwork. Although the Internet was widely used by academia in the 1980s, the subsequent commercialization of the Internet in the 1990s and beyond incorporated its services and technologies into virtually every aspect of modern life. The test page was released on 13 April 2005 by the Web Standards Project. The Acid2 test page will be displayed correctly in any application that follows the World Wide Web Consortium and Internet Engineering Task Force specifications for these technologies. These specifications are known as web standards because they describe how technologies used on the web are expected to function. Acid2 tests rendering flaws in web browsers and other applications that render HTML. Named after the acid test for gold, it was developed in the spirit of Acid1, a relatively narrow test of compliance with the Cascading Style Sheets 1.0 (CSS1) standard. As with Acid1, an application passes the test if the way it displays the test page matches a reference image. (Full article...) The term is derived from the word "elite", and the usage it describes is a specialized form of shorthand. The Protocol Wars were a long-running debate in computer science that occurred from the 1970s to the 1990s, when engineers, organizations and nations became polarized over the issue of which communication protocol would result in the best and most robust networks. This culminated in the Internet–OSI Standards War in the 1980s and early 1990s, which was ultimately "won" by the Internet protocol suite (TCP/IP) by the mid-1990s when it became the dominant protocol suite through rapid adoption of the Internet. In the late 1960s and early 1970s, the pioneers of packet switching technology built computer networks providing data communication, that is the ability to transfer data between points or nodes. As more of these networks emerged in the mid to late 1970s, the debate about communication protocols became a "battle for access standards". An international collaboration between several national postal, telegraph and telephone (PTT) providers and commercial operators led to the X.25 standard in 1976, which was adopted on public data networks providing global coverage. Separately, proprietary data communication protocols emerged, most notably IBM's Systems Network Architecture in 1974 and Digital Equipment Corporation's DECnet in 1975. The United States Department of Defense (DoD) developed TCP/IP during the 1970s in collaboration with universities and researchers in the US, UK, and France. IPv4 was released in 1981 and was made the standard for all DoD computer networking. By 1984, the international reference model OSI model, which was not compatible with TCP/IP, had been agreed upon. Many European governments (particularly France, West Germany, and the UK) and the United States Department of Commerce mandated compliance with the OSI model, while the US Department of Defense planned to transition from TCP/IP to OSI. Meanwhile, the development of a complete Internet protocol suite by 1989, and partnerships with the telecommunication and computer industry to incorporate TCP/IP software into various operating systems, laid the foundation for the widespread adoption of TCP/IP as a comprehensive protocol suite. While OSI developed its networking standards in the late 1980s, TCP/IP came into widespread use on multi-vendor networks for internetworking and as the core component of the emerging Internet. Chad Meredith Hurley (born 1977) is co-founder and Chief Executive Officer of the popular San Bruno, California-based video sharing website YouTube, one of the biggest providers of videos on the Internet. In June 2006, he was voted 28th on Business 2.0's "50 people who matter" list. In October 2006 he sold YouTube for $1.65 billion to Google. Hurley worked in eBay's PayPal division before starting YouTube with fellow PayPal colleagues Steve Chen and Jawed Karim. One of his tasks at eBay involved designing the original PayPal logo. Newsweek describes Hurley as a user interface expert. He was primarily responsible for the tagging and video sharing aspects of YouTube. YouTube was born when the founders (Hurley, Chen, and Karim) wanted to share some videos from a dinner party with friends in San Francisco in January 2005. Sending the clips around by e-mail was a bust: The e-mails kept getting rejected because they were so big. Posting the videos online was a headache, too. So they got to work to design something simpler. In 11 months the site became one of the most popular sites on the Internet because the founders designed it so people can post almost anything they like on YouTube in minutes.
